Output ae66e00aa80159c5c7e53cb1fa1889c12cd6d00ba92fd863650711f13b91ec0c:59

value
75483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c71b4688f434481c72fa58a43bf0175dc8d171c OP_EQUAL
address
3EVcjk1zkKA1V9HHJaRaq8yY1NwiBQquwB
transaction
ae66e00aa80159c5c7e53cb1fa1889c12cd6d00ba92fd863650711f13b91ec0c